Type
ORACLE
Validation date
2025-01-21 02:52: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01488,
    "usd": 0.01545
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00016A296E22605715C4769AC81E3B89EDFF724623E689B5698B13A72AF21F3A2034

Previous signature

6F2C8D5134EE56B05AEBF4F12F7C2FF3D102595083E974AC251BE8C0DDAAE3890A1C79E5C9AEE83AFD5B6585375F7CD2C3953CA3AD9402A5F329A353229A2F09

Origin signature

3046022100B1927FE2C1BECFE65F93F58ECA49833461420A05682AB5607F5130C5CEE8027F02210092BF54485D83B3FAFC49FF4BC51BF8F4390015ECF5FDBA0A393C266005B70A5D

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

0073A7E9708241D2E910539C3CA5C970CB7E9EEC47A3A341342146C3E00148CA60

Coordinator signature

5E86234E482E5D1C8769C73F114D5879B6B37730A44A9F41C6B78742016483909722767A77E69D5673A65B5266DE94E984A96408E104429DD67AFC4A7B35C30C

Validator #1 public key

0001317C62B18497CFF9889458C363EB606128DC6D370E13562B3D3A77DEA180D66F

Validator #1 signature

F833AE8E47BD4CCF082C2249B73C4224BB65CBDFA2ECAB0B0B2EDA3E0C76728C9788DAE3C7FA8CEF0B2B2E2D75A32EF2663B9F28E933A1457E566A9CC98E1603

Validator #2 public key

00018745E16C61F7B239A4BE2FCFD6BED496A5860AC8DD7CFA92B59023685BADDBAE

Validator #2 signature

C3AF19EBB6056DEAC9EC86C6EA055C65673DF9DF5FD90E0FBD8BE379E93EADFDBB8212ECD888937C29F42C70FF21A95A814A7A6D925C2E5544D5F274A631FC00